After years of working on your PhD and being in academia, transitioning into a Data Science career can be a culture shock.
It’s important to understand how the roles you are wanting to apply to vary; what industry is it in? What are the main focus of the projects? Who will you be working alongside? What are the end goals the team would be working on achieving? Does your chosen industry have anything to do with your PhD and academic research?
